Q: Why should I use a conical washer instead of a standard flat washer for my kart seat?
A: Standard flat washers do not provide a flush fit for countersunk (flat head) screws. The Kartech KM625B is specifically machined to match the angle of your screw head, which self-centers the hardware and distributes clamping force evenly to prevent the bolt from pulling through your fiberglass or carbon fiber seat.
